Hoi An Old Town Sunset Viewpoint is a must-visit location for anyone exploring the ancient streets of Hội An. Situated along the river, this spot provides a front-row seat to the daily spectacle of the sun setting over the water, casting a golden glow on the historic architecture. Visitors often combine the view with a leisurely walk along the riverbanks or across the local bridges. It is particularly enchanting during the full moon and the Lantern Festival, when the water reflects hundreds of glowing lights. While it can get crowded during peak festival times, the atmosphere remains vibrant and visually stunning.

Hoi An Old Town Sunset Viewpoint is praised for offering some of the most spectacular vistas in the city. Visitors highly recommend arriving before the sun begins to set to enjoy a peaceful walk along the river. The viewpoint on the bridge is a favorite for watching the sunset and the full moon simultaneously. While the atmosphere is generally serene, reviewers note that it becomes very crowded during the Lantern Festival. Some feedback mentions that infrastructure like the Cam Nam Bridge may be under maintenance during major holidays. Overall, it is considered an essential spot for capturing the beauty of Hội An at dusk.
